English > 5 senses of the word fag:
NOUNperson fag, fagot, faggot, fairy, nance, pansy, queen, queer, poof, poove, poufoffensive term for an openly homosexual man
artifactfag, cigarette, cigaret, coffin nail, buttfinely ground tobacco wrapped in paper
VERBsocialfagact as a servant for older boys, in British public schools
socialfag, labor, labour, toil, travail, grind, drudge, dig, moilwork hard
bodyfag, tire, wear upon, tire out, wear, weary, jade, wear out, outwear, wear down, fag out, fatigueexhaust or get tired through overuse or great strain / strain / strain or stress
